dc.description.abstractThis book is an introduction to many of the topics that an engineer needs to master in order to successfully design experiments and measurements systems. In addition to descriptions of common measurement systems, the book describes computerized data acquisition systems, common statistical techniques, and guidelines for planning and documenting experiments. More comprehensive studies of available literature and consultation with product vendors are appropriate when engaging in a significant real-world experimental program. It is to be expected that the skills of the experimenter will be enhanced by more advanced courses in experimental and instrumentations systems design and practical experience. The design of an experimental or measurements system is inherently and interdisciplinary activity. For example, the instrumentation and control system of a process plant might require the skills of chemical engineers, mechanical engineers, electrical engineers and computer engineers. Similarly, the specification of the instrumentation used to measure the haemoglobin status in dengue patients will involve medical doctor, electrical engineers and computer engineers. Based on this fact, the topics presented in this book have been selected to prepare engineering students and practicing engineers of different disciplines to design instrumentations projects and measurements systems. Experimental methods are not unimportant, but analytical studies have, at times, seemed to deserve more emphasis, particularly with enormous computing power that is available. Laboratory work has also become more sophisticated in the modern engineering curricula. This book is generally suitable as an accompaniment to laboratory sessions oriented around the specific experiments available at a particular institution.en_US
